The Energized Way
Posted by Simon Baker
Go live every week. Follow the money. Keep options open. Work with customers every day. Work in one place. Collaborate intensively. Talk face-to-face. Grow friendships. Create features iteratively. Code in pairs. Drive with tests. Fix defects immediately. Never compromise quality. See the whole. Fail fast; learn quickly. Have fun. Be remarkable.

Gardening for facilitators
Posted by Gus Power
If you're new to light-touch leadership you may find yourself focusing on the big events (standups, retrospectives, planning games, showcase, beer). However it's the little-noticed gardening work that happens over the course of an iteration that really helps a team work together and deliver effectively. Here's a few examples, some of which may be specific to our environment.
